2017-02-28 36 views
0

对我来说第一要点:我想实现websocket。我不需要socketIO的回退选项。如果我使用Flask-SocketIO来实现服务器上的websockets,那么我需要一个socketio客户端吗?

我希望“我的客户”在他们停留在websockets协议后尽快实现他们想要的任何内容。即类似于:var ws = new WebSocket

所以..如果服务器是Flask-SocketIO,会不会有简单的js WebSocket的工作?

ADDIONAL NOTES: Python第一! 我想设置一个服务器,它只会响应(实际上只发送)到websockets,没有关联的网页。 (是的,我对WS很满意,如果你问的话,我不需要WSS,))。 我曾尝试在服务器端使用烧瓶插座 https://github.com/kennethreitz/flask-sockets 但它给我一些问题。就像立即关闭连接并在网络上遇到许多类似问题,我找不到解决方案。很难调试。所以在我开始开发一个新的服务器之前...

回答

5

不幸的是,你不能在普通的WebSocket客户端上使用Socket.IO服务器。对不起,这不是Flask-SocketIO的。

(如果这是不明确,这是瓶,SocketIO发言的作者)

+0

不接手这个职位,但我不得不说,烧瓶socketio是真棒!感谢您创建这样一个真棒包! – harryparkdotio

+0

@Miguel非常感谢!作者的一个答案是一个定义;) – mariotti

+1

@Pipskweak我不想让烧瓶socketio不太棒,再次感谢。 – mariotti

相关问题